The Seychelles Financial Services Authority (FSA) issued a public alert about a circulating “warning document” that falsely claims to be from the FSA and advises people affected by the liquidation of an unregulated entity to contact the bank issuer. The FSA said the communication was not issued by the authority, the signatory named “Peter Eugenia Wallace” is not known to or employed by the FSA, and the seal on the document is not authentic. It urged investors and the public to exercise caution and to verify the authenticity of documents or information purportedly issued or published by the FSA, particularly where there are suspicions about their veracity.
